How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sumter?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 29150 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,195 | $725 | $2,000 |
| 29150 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,473 | $971 | $1,815 |
| 29150 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,350 | $1,350 | $1,350 |

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 29150?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 29150 range from $971 to $1,815,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$971 to $1,815.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,350 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,350.
